Amadeus MCP 服务器

Amadeus MCP 服务器

通过 Amadeus MCP 服务器为您的 AI 工作流带来实时、对话式航班搜索——集成旅行数据,自动生成行程,并通过一个简单易用的服务器赋能客户支持机器人。

“Amadeus” MCP 服务器的作用是什么?

Amadeus MCP(模型上下文协议)服务器是社区开发的 MCP 服务器,旨在与 Amadeus 航班报价搜索 API 集成。它使 AI 助手和兼容 MCP 的客户端能够通过自然语言查询,搜索指定日期两地之间的航班选项。通过结合 Amadeus API 和大型语言模型(LLM),该服务器让用户能够通过对话界面获取详细的航班报价,包括起降时间、航空公司、价格等信息。这极大地提升了开发者和用户的工作流程,实现了航班数据的实时获取,使旅行规划更加顺畅和交互式。

Prompt 列表

仓库中未明确提及 prompt 模板。

资源列表

仓库未明确记录资源原语。

工具列表

  • 航班报价搜索工具
    • 将 Amadeus 航班报价搜索 API 以工具形式开放,允许客户端和 LLM 获取指定地点和日期之间的航班选项。需要输入参数如出发地、目的地、出行日期和票数。

此 MCP 服务器的应用场景

  • 旅行规划与预订
    • 开发者可为用户构建自然语言快速查找和比价航班的工具,简化旅行规划与预订流程。
  • 对话式 AI 助手
    • 集成至聊天机器人或虚拟助手,用于解答航班相关问题,如“帮我找下下周五巴黎到东京最便宜的航班”。
  • 自动生成行程
    • 让系统能根据用户偏好和可用航班自动推荐和组装旅行行程。
  • 客户支持自动化
    • 赋能客户服务机器人,实时提供最新航班信息,提升响应速度和客户满意度。
  • 与旅行应用集成
    • 通过嵌入 AI 驱动的航班搜索功能,直接提升旅行应用或平台的用户体验。

如何设置

Windsurf

  1. 确保已安装所有所需前置条件(Node.js 等)。
  2. 找到或创建您的 Windsurf 配置文件。
  3. 使用以下 JSON 片段将 Amadeus MCP 服务器添加为服务器:
    {
      "mcpServers": {
        "amadeus": {
          "command": "@donghyun-chae/mcp-amadeus@latest",
          "args": []
        }
      }
    }
    
  4. 保存配置并重启 Windsurf。
  5. 通过查看服务器日志或界面,确认连接是否成功。

API 密钥安全: 通过环境变量设置您的 Amadeus API 凭据(参考 .env.example):

{
  "env": {
    "AMADEUS_CLIENT_ID": "your_client_id",
    "AMADEUS_CLIENT_SECRET": "your_client_secret"
  },
  "inputs": {}
}

Claude

  1. 安装前置条件并打开 Claude 配置面板。
  2. 编辑配置以添加 Amadeus MCP 服务器:
    {
      "mcpServers": {
        "amadeus": {
          "command": "@donghyun-chae/mcp-amadeus@latest",
          "args": []
        }
      }
    }
    
  3. 保存并重启 Claude。
  4. 确认客户端已可用 Amadeus 工具。

API 密钥安全:
同样使用环境变量设置。

Cursor

  1. 确保已安装所有前置条件。
  2. 打开 Cursor 应用配置。
  3. 添加如下条目:
    {
      "mcpServers": {
        "amadeus": {
          "command": "@donghyun-chae/mcp-amadeus@latest",
          "args": []
        }
      }
    }
    
  4. 保存更改并重启 Cursor。
  5. 确认 MCP 集成已激活。

API 密钥安全:
依然采用环境变量方式。

Cline

  1. 确认已安装所有前置条件。
  2. 编辑 Cline 的配置文件。
  3. 插入如下 JSON:
    {
      "mcpServers": {
        "amadeus": {
          "command": "@donghyun-chae/mcp-amadeus@latest",
          "args": []
        }
      }
    }
    
  4. 保存并重启 Cline。
  5. 确认 Amadeus MCP 服务器正在运行且可访问。

API 密钥安全:
如上所示,设置 API 凭据为环境变量。

如何在流程中使用此 MCP

在 FlowHunt 中使用 MCP

要将 MCP 服务器集成到 FlowHunt 工作流中,请先在流程中添加 MCP 组件并将其连接到您的 AI 代理:

FlowHunt MCP flow

点击 MCP 组件打开配置面板。在系统 MCP 配置部分,插入您的 MCP 服务器信息,格式如下:

{
  "amadeus":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

配置完成后,AI 代理即可作为工具使用该 MCP,具备其全部功能和能力。请务必将 “amadeus” 替换为您 MCP 服务器的实际名称,并将 URL 替换为您自己的 MCP 服务器地址。


概览

部分可用性详情/备注
概述Amadeus MCP 服务器用于通过 Amadeus API 进行航班搜索
Prompt 列表未记录 prompt 模板
资源列表未记录 MCP 资源原语
工具列表航班搜索工具
API 密钥安全使用环境变量,见 .env.example
采样支持(评估中较次要)未提及
支持 Roots未提及

综上表所示,Amadeus MCP 服务器提供了直接的航班搜索集成,但缺乏 prompt 模板、资源和诸如 roots、采样等高级 MCP 功能的文档。它在实际旅行/航班场景下表现良好,但若能为开发者提供更全面的文档和功能曝光,将更具吸引力。

MCP 评分

是否有 LICENSE✅ (MIT)
是否有至少一个工具
Fork 数量7
Star 数量23

常见问题

Amadeus MCP 服务器的作用是什么?

它充当 AI 助手与 Amadeus 航班报价搜索 API 之间的桥梁,使用户能够通过自然语言查询搜索、比较和获取航班报价。

主要的应用场景有哪些?

旅行规划与预订、对话式 AI 助手、自动生成行程、客户支持自动化,以及集成到旅行应用以获取实时航班数据。

我可以通过服务器获取哪些数据?

您可以访问详细的航班报价,包括起降时间、航空公司、价格等,基于用户输入的位置和日期。

如何保护我的 API 密钥?

请按照每个客户端的设置说明,将您的 Amadeus API 凭据作为环境变量(AMADEUS_CLIENT_ID 和 AMADEUS_CLIENT_SECRET)存储。

是否提供 prompt 模板或资源原语?

当前仓库未记录具体的 prompt 模板或资源原语。

运行 Amadeus MCP 服务器需要什么?

您需要 Node.js(或其他前置条件)、Amadeus API 凭据,以及如 Windsurf、Claude、Cursor 或 Cline 等兼容 MCP 的客户端。

用 Amadeus MCP 提升您的旅行应用

将 Amadeus MCP 服务器集成到 FlowHunt,让您的 AI 代理能够使用自然语言访问、比较并预订航班。

了解更多

Flightradar24 MCP 服务器集成
Flightradar24 MCP 服务器集成

Flightradar24 MCP 服务器集成

通过 Flightradar24 MCP 服务器,将实时航班追踪集成到您的 AI 工作流中。访问实时航空数据,监控航班,并在 FlowHunt 流程中提升旅行及态势感知能力。...

2 分钟阅读
AI Aviation +5
旅行规划器 MCP 服务器
旅行规划器 MCP 服务器

旅行规划器 MCP 服务器

旅行规划器 MCP 服务器通过 Google 地图 API 将 AI 助手连接到实时旅行数据,实现智能行程生成、地点发现和路线规划,适用于对话式代理和工作流。...

2 分钟阅读
Travel AI +5
Variflight MCP 服务器集成
Variflight MCP 服务器集成

Variflight MCP 服务器集成

Variflight MCP 服务器连接 AI 智能体与航空数据,使 FlowHunt 用户能够通过无缝集成 VariFlight API 搜索航班、追踪实时飞机、获取天气预报和航班舒适度指标。...

2 分钟阅读
MCP Aviation +4